void
cpu_reset(void)
{
	bus_space_tag_t bst;
	bus_space_handle_t bsh;

	bst = fdtbus_bs_tag;

	/* Enable WDT */
	bus_space_map(bst, LPC_CLKPWR_PHYS_BASE, LPC_CLKPWR_SIZE, 0, &bsh);
	bus_space_write_4(bst, bsh, LPC_CLKPWR_TIMCLK_CTRL,
	    LPC_CLKPWR_TIMCLK_CTRL_WATCHDOG);
	bus_space_unmap(bst, bsh, LPC_CLKPWR_SIZE);

	/* Instant assert of RESETOUT_N with pulse length 1ms */
	bus_space_map(bst, LPC_WDTIM_PHYS_BASE, LPC_WDTIM_SIZE, 0, &bsh);
	bus_space_write_4(bst, bsh, LPC_WDTIM_PULSE, 13000);
	bus_space_write_4(bst, bsh, LPC_WDTIM_MCTRL, 0x70);
	bus_space_unmap(bst, bsh, LPC_WDTIM_SIZE);

	for (;;)
		continue;
}
